Biography
Threads of guitar, flutes, Irish whistles, cello, piano, percussion and atmospheric wizardry seemlessly blend into an enchanting harmony that is unmistakably Gandalfian.
Gandalf plays many and varied instruments (acoustic and electric guitars, sitar, saz, charango, bouzouki, balaphon, piano, synthesizers and sample-keyboards, and various percussion), blends acoustic with electronic and spherical sounds and weaves folk-elements into symphonic structures to create his unmistakable and unique style. He has worked with international artists, including former Genesis guitarist Steve Hackett, Tunesian vocalist and oud player Dhafer Yossef and English cellist and vocalist Emily Burridge a.k.a. White Horse, whom he met while on a concert tour in Brazil. Gandalf has also written music for theatre and film. Although Gandalf has international recognition, his recordings have been primarily released in Europe.
